Default anyone making steering wheels for the f-bodies?

Just wanted to see if anyone's replaced the stock steering wheel with something a little more "racy" (thicker rim, different spoke placement, looks). Although the steering wheel controls for radio are nice, I've just never liked the look or feel of the stocker. I suppose wanting to keep the airbag would narrow the list to next to nothing...but thought I'd ask anyway.
